2018年12月26日

循环体

for(exp1;exp2;exp3;){

     循环体

}

exp1:无条件的执行第一个表达式

exp2:是判断是否能执行循环体的条件

exp3:做增量的操作

 

break:结束for的循环

continue:代表跳过当此循环,进入下次循环

练习题

<script type="text/javascript">
   0到100奇数的和
   var sum = 0;
   for(var i= 1;i<=100;i+=2){
    sum+=i;
   }
   document.write(sum+'<br/>');
   0到100偶数的和
   var sum = 0;
   for(var i= 0;i<=100;i+=2){
    sum+=i;
   }
   document.write(sum);
   
   for(var i=1;i>=100;i++){
    if()
   }
  </script>

for循环的嵌套

正的九九乘法表

<table border='1' cellpadding='0' bgcolor='#fff' width:'80%'>
    <script>
     for(var i=1;i<=9;i++){
      document.write('<tr>');
       for(var j=1;j<=i;j++){
        document.write('<td>'+i+'x'+j+'='+i*j+'</td>');
       }
      document.write('</tr>');
     }
    </script>
   </table>

反的九九乘法表
   
   <table border='1' cellpaddig='0' bgcolor='#fff' width:'80%'>
    <script>
     for(var i=9;i>=1;i--){
      document.write('<tr>');
      for(var j=1;j<=i;j++){
       document.write('<td>'+i+'x'+j+'='+i*j+'</td>');
      }
      document.write('</tr>');
     }
    </script>
   </table>

posted on 2018-12-28 15:23  duleilei  阅读(140)  评论(0编辑  收藏  举报

导航